Dori listeners got creative in showing their Halloween spirit — and their feelings about the Puget Sound — in the first-ever Dori Monson Show Pumpkin Carving Contest.

The challenge was to carve a pumpkin with an image that best represents Seattle. And from Sasquatch to Seahawks, it’s clear that Seattle means many different things to different people — though several jack-o-lanterns held a common theme.

Alan Goerner’s “Ballard Junk-o-Lantern,” as he calls it, took first place in this year’s contest, scoring Goerner a giant 12th Man flag and two tickets to the Taste of the Seahawks event.
